A Closer Look - EASD Overview

The Elizabethtown Area School District, an award-winning public school system, is nestled in the picturesque setting of Lancaster County, just 20 miles from Harrisburg and Lancaster. It boasts easy accessibility via major roadways and the rail system.

Serving nearly 3,600 students, the District employs approximately 450 full and part-time staff across three elementary schools, one middle school, and one high school. Supporting this three-pronged approach is our Benefits-Based Accountability Framework and Effective Operations. Benefits-based Accountability is built on the following seven distinct pillars, each with its own unique success criteria:

  1. Student Learning
  2. Student Readiness
  3. Engaged, Well-Rounded Students
  4. Well-Being
  5. Community Connections
  6. Effective Adults
  7. Effective Systems.
